Dutch
Etymology
From Middle Dutch canse, borrowed from Lua error in Module:parameters at line 95: Parameter 2 should be a valid language, etymology language or family code; the value "ONF." is not valid. See WT:LOL, WT:LOL/E and WT:LOF., from Vulgar Latin *cadentia, from cadō (“to fall”), referring to the falling of dice.
Cognate with French chance, English chance.
Pronunciation
Noun
kans f (plural kansen, diminutive kansje n)
- chance
- opportunity
- (mathematics) probability
